aboutsummaryrefslogtreecommitdiffstats
path: root/server/views.py
diff options
context:
space:
mode:
authorAndrea Lepori <alepori@student.ethz.ch>2020-07-31 14:12:21 +0200
committerAndrea Lepori <alepori@student.ethz.ch>2020-07-31 14:12:21 +0200
commit4fd7f5a580d45be75018f1f3ddf6182dbefa0edc (patch)
treeb75ca4c41b5cc97a0a9d298b7b2fff1a90ce997b /server/views.py
parentself delete of medical data (diff)
downloadscout-subs-4fd7f5a580d45be75018f1f3ddf6182dbefa0edc.tar.gz
scout-subs-4fd7f5a580d45be75018f1f3ddf6182dbefa0edc.zip
requirements for python
Diffstat (limited to 'server/views.py')
-rw-r--r--server/views.py6
1 files changed, 3 insertions, 3 deletions
diff --git a/server/views.py b/server/views.py
index b4bd06e..01e8109 100644
--- a/server/views.py
+++ b/server/views.py
@@ -33,7 +33,7 @@ def index(request):
context = {}
parent_group = request.user.groups.values_list('name', flat=True)[
0]
- users = User.objects.filter(groups__name=parent_group).order_by("id")
+ users = User.objects.filter(groups__name=parent_group).order_by("-id")
users_out = []
for user in users:
@@ -48,10 +48,10 @@ def index(request):
group = Group.objects.get(name=parent_group)
if request.user.is_staff:
public_types = DocumentType.objects.filter(
- Q(group_private=False) | Q(group=group) & Q(enabled=True))
+ Q(group_private=False) | Q(group=group) & Q(enabled=True)).order_by("-id")
else:
public_types = DocumentType.objects.filter(
- Q(group_private=False) & Q(enabled=True))
+ Q(group_private=False) & Q(enabled=True)).order_by("-id")
docs = []
for doc in public_types:
ref_docs = Document.objects.filter(document_type=doc)